- Feb 24, 2019
-
-
Romain Bignon authored
-
- Dec 17, 2018
-
-
- Nov 10, 2018
-
-
-
All Page classes have a logger, mimic it.
-
- Aug 18, 2018
-
-
-
This can be useful for responsive sites.
-
- Jun 09, 2018
-
-
-
It may be executed multiple times per source page though. Since property "page" will generate a Page object on every access. It should be idempotent then.
-
Since pages can have a lot of javascript, URL change does not reflect when page changed. Use full page_source instead, and save when browser.page attribute is used. Requests can't be saved. page_source contains inline images which can be heavy, so support a configurable size quota.
-
By default, phantomjs might log in current dir. Use a temp path or responses_dirname if available.
-
- May 05, 2018
-
-
Warning: it doesn't seem to work on Firefox or PhantomJS. It has a restriction: operation is done per domain.
-
Selenium treats frames and iframes in a different way. One has to "switch to" a frame before being able to interact with the frame. Then, one must go out of it. Add a context manager to limit block scope and also a condition wrapper.
-
Weboob modules can thus set their own settings
-
- Apr 15, 2018
-
-
This keeps compatibility with standard weboob browsers, required for URL class.
-
- Mar 31, 2018
-
-
Contains SeleniumBrowser, SeleniumPage
-